8 Easy Steps To Clean Your Car's AC Filter
Locate the AC filter: It's usually found behind the glove box or in the engine compartment.
Turn off the ignition: Ensure the engine is turned off and the AC system is not running.
Remove the filter: Pull out the filter and inspect it for dirt and debris.
Wash the filter: Use a gentle soap solution and rinse thoroughly. Avoid using high-pressure washes, which can damage the filter.
Let it dry: Allow the filter to air dry before reinstalling it.
Reinstall the filter: Put the filter back in its original position and secure it with the clips or screws.
Test the AC: Turn on the AC and check for a noticeable improvement in air quality and cooling performance.
Repeat as needed: Schedule regular filter cleaning to maintain optimal AC performance.

Q: Can I use compressed air to clean the filter?
A: While compressed air can be effective, it's not recommended, as it can push debris further into the system and cause damage.
Q: Can I clean the filter with dish soap?
A: Yes, but be cautious not to use too much soap, which can leave residue on the filter. A mild soap solution is recommended.
Q: How often should I replace the AC filter?
A: The filter should be replaced every 30,000 to 60,000 miles or when it becomes clogged with debris. It's also a good idea to check the filter type and manufacturer recommendations.
